ISLAMABAD: Defence Minister Khawaja Asif has said that India is trying to divert the attention of the international community from the Kashmir dispute.

In an interview, the defence minister said that the Indian government is making all efforts to shift the focus of the world community from Kashmir with false claims of surgical strikes against Pakistan and the attack on Uri military base.

He said that Indian atrocities against the people of Kashmir are on the rise adding that the country is violating basic human rights in the disputed territory.

He said that the neighboring country has resorted to escalate hostilities with Pakistan in order to shift the focus of world community from atrocities in occupied Kashmir.

He went on to say that India is unable to control the situation prevailing in the region following the killing of freedom fighter Burhan Wani.

Asif stated that different viewpoints regarding Uri military base attack are emerging in the neighboring country as its government has been unable to prove their claims.
